Jacques VILLON - Le potager aux citrouilles, 1962 - Original hand-signed lithograph

Jacques Villon (1875-1963)
Le potager aux citrouilles, 1962

Original lithograph in colors on Arches paper (watermark)
from "Huit Lithographies" portfolio.

Signed lower edge : 'Jacques Villon'.
From an edition of 175 (100/175)
Published by Louis Carré, Paris, 1962

Dimensions:
+ Size of the sheet: 42,2 x 52,4 cm - 16,6 x 20,60 in

Condition: very good condition

Jacques Villon : (1875-1963) is a french cubist painter, and is the brother of Marcel Duchamp. He chose the pseudonym de Villon in tribute to the poet François Villon. He started his artistic career with engraving and illustration. In the beginning of the 1900's, he is influenced by Edgar Degas, and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ec. Some years later, he is part of the group of Puteaux. His work includes more than 700 canvases. Aged 82, he realised 5 stain-glass windows of the Saint-Etienne Cathedral in Metz. His works are included in the collections of the biggest museums in France, Japan, USA, Italy, Australia, Mexico, Portugal, Great Britain...
